Transaction 31f126f40728ed9c55e716707080964cf96c397a81aa0e9557b3a91821682ee7
1 Input
1 Output
-
31f126f40728ed9c55e716707080964cf96c397a81aa0e9557b3a91821682ee7:0
- value
- 104313
- script pubkey
- OP_0 OP_PUSHBYTES_20 e55e434f1dc6587cdcf684f454c7aac6161f03d2
- address
- bc1qu40yxncacev8eh8ksn69f3a2cctp7q7j0cvnlg